There are a number of factors which affect the surface temperature of planets. First, there is sunlight which is a source of warmth. Then, there are various types of atmosphere, which retain warmth to varying degrees. Then, there is the radiation of heat into space, by means of infrared radiation, which happens on the side of the planet that faces away from the sun, and cools the planet.

What three factors determine the type of soil that can develop in an area?

The three factors that determine the type of soil in an area are climate, organisms, and parent material. Climate influences the rate of weathering and decomposition, organisms contribute to the organic matter content, and parent material determines the mineral composition of the soil.


What three factors determine the rate at which rock weathers?

The rate at which rock weathers is primarily determined by climate (temperature and precipitation), the type of rock (composition and structure), and the presence of living organisms (such as plants or bacteria) that can contribute to the weathering process.

What are the three factors that influenced the formation of soil?

Three factors that influence the formation of soil are climate, parent material, and time. Climate affects the rate of weathering and organic matter decomposition, while parent material determines the types of minerals present in the soil. Time allows for the accumulation of organic matter and the development of soil horizons.


Why are world maps of climate soil formation and natural vegetation so similar?

World maps of climate, soil formation, and natural vegetation are similar because these factors are interlinked. Climate influences soil by determining factors such as temperature and precipitation, which in turn affect soil properties. Natural vegetation is adapted to the prevailing climate and soil conditions, leading to similar distribution patterns of these three factors on a global scale.

What Determines The Three Main Types Of Climate Zone?

The three main types of climate zones (tropical, temperate, polar) are determined by factors such as latitude, proximity to bodies of water, and elevation. Regions near the equator typically have a tropical climate, while those at mid-latitudes experience temperate climates, and areas near the poles have polar climates due to the Earth's curvature and amount of solar radiation received.

What are the three factors that determine the amount of potential energy?

The three factors that determine the amount of potential energy are the object's mass, the height it is lifted to, and the acceleration due to gravity. These factors combine to determine the gravitational potential energy of an object.
